my screen has got diagonal pixellated patterns

The screen on my iMac has stopped working and I do not get an Apple logo unless I start it up in safe mode. If I do it has diagonal pixellated patterns which make it impossible to see anything. In normal start up mode there is just a strange pattern and the pointer becomes some lines of text.

I am told that it must be the logic board. Is it possible to get a replacement? Does anyone know where?

I would agree, I have seen many fail in the same way, poor quality graphics chips that are part of the logic board. for the cost of a new logic board, you are half way to a New iMac, and given the age of the machine, it may be time.
